Abstract

This paper reports the case of a 10-month-old male infant with Beckwith-Wiedemann syndrome (BWS) who presented with a reducible right inguinal mass and an empty scrotum for 10 months and was admitted for elective surgery. Preoperative ultrasonography revealed a right adrenal mass, which was pathologically diagnosed as ganglioneuroblastoma (GNB) after surgical excision. The patient exhibited characteristic features of BWS, including omphalocele, flame-shaped nevus on the forehead, bilateral earlobe creases, and embryonal tumor. Next-generation sequencing identified a heterozygous mutation in the CDKN1C gene (chr11:2905365), confirming the diagnosis of BWS. Early diagnosis, standardized management, and tumor surveillance are crucial for improving prognosis in children with BWS. Ultrasonography enables early detection of tumors and informs clinical decision-making regarding intervention.

期刊介绍: The Chinese Journal of Contemporary Pediatrics (CJCP) is a peer-reviewed open access periodical in the field of pediatrics that is sponsored by the Central South University/Xiangya Hospital of Central South University and under the auspices of the Ministry of Education of China. It is cited as a source in the scientific and technological papers of Chinese journals, the Chinese Science Citation Database (CSCD), and is one of the core Chinese periodicals in the Peking University Library. CJCP has been indexed by MEDLINE/PubMed/PMC of the American National Library, American Chemical Abstracts (CA), Holland Medical Abstracts (EM), Western Pacific Region Index Medicus (WPRIM), Scopus and EBSCO. It is a monthly periodical published on the 15th of every month, and is distributed both at home and overseas. The Chinese series publication number is CN 43-1301/R;ISSN 1008-8830. The tenet of CJCP is to “reflect the latest advances and be open to the world”. The periodical reports the most recent advances in the contemporary pediatric field. The majority of the readership is pediatric doctors and researchers.
